The first time I laced up my boots for a Kings Canyon trip, I felt it was going to be unforgettable – and with Wayoutback Tours, I was extra keen. Out here in the NT the desert isn’t just sand dunes and spinifex. It’s a living, breathing landscape that shifts with every sunrise, storm and story.
I’ve been exploring the Red Centre for years – from the mighty Uluru to the Olgas – but nothing matched the sheer scale of the Rim Walk at Kings Canyon. The cliffs, the Garden of Eden oasis, the shifting colours at dawn and dusk… it’s an experience that is more than a bucket-list item; it leaves a mark on you.
